## Further reading: catalog cache invalidation

Reviewers: Meridock's catalog cache uses event-driven invalidation, not TTLs. Any change touching product writers must emit an invalidation event or stale prices will surface. Check the event contract before approving; silent schema drift here has burned us. Bulk imports bypass the normal path and use the sweep job instead. Design rationale, event schemas, and known edge cases are documented on the internal page.

dashboard of bafof-hafog = https://confluence.lumiclabs.internal/display/browse/display/6a09a20a

During pre-release checks for the 5.1 train, we found that three Restockly planner nodes in the Delmora region are running hand-edited values: the demand-forecast horizon and the truck-capacity ceiling no longer match the repository baseline. This likely explains the inconsistent restock routes reported last sprint. Before you cut the release, we should decide whether to codify the edits or revert the nodes. To make the comparison easier, the intended baseline configuration for the planner service is included below.

config for kagup-hahig:
druwyn:
  pin: 2801
  metrics_host: metrics.druwyn.zemvarlabs.internal
  tenant: sorius
  seal: seal_798a43d7

# Break-Glass: Telemetry Compression

If the Quillstream compressor wedges and payloads back up, use break-glass access to the packer node. Disable zstd dictionary reload first, then flush the ring buffer. Do not restart the agent mid-flush. Access requires the sealed recovery credential; log your use in the incident channel. The break-glass vault opens with the recovery passphrase below.

strongbox words: praax-wenwyn